The Vail Chapel seats 250. Both piano and organ are available at the chapel. The Bride and Bridal party has private access to the bridal dressing suite as she prepares for her wedding day. We request that weddings be scheduled through a resident clergy member. Each couple should contact a specific congregation directly in order to schedule a date and time for a wedding and rehearsal. You can check our on-line calendar for specific days before calling if that is more convenient. Guest clergy can officiate if they are sponsored through the resident clergy. This beautiful mountain alpine chapel with vaulted wooded ceilings and amazing creekside access is nestled along the Gore Creek in the heart of the Vail Village. Vail Interfaith Chapel has been a place of solace and celebration since 1969. During any season, we offer a unique, quaint chapel with sprawling creekside venues for religious and community sponsored events. The upstairs worship space seats up to 250 guests, including the balcony and North Chapel.

Our recent $7.2M renovation inside and outside, now provides air conditioning, new carpet and reupholstered pews, elevator, snowmelt on front entry steps and parking lot, updated lighting both inside and outside, solar panels, handicapped entrance, two newly designed creekside flagstone terraces and landscaped creekside habitat.

Our gorgeous private bridal suite allows the brides and bridesmaids to relax and prepare for the big event. Amenities include 2 stations with large mirrors, extra electrical outlets, full length 3-way mirror, 2 comfortable lounge chairs, a seating area for four, large closets for hanging dresses, a vintage refrigerator, and a private entrance.

Chapel Policies

In the spirit of working within the context and natural beauty of our mountain chapels, these policies are offered based on extensive experience in hosting weddings. To make sure your wedding day goes as smoothly as possible with no conflicts, please read the guidelines thoroughly. The success of your wedding and your exclusive chapel and creekside terrace buyout is very important to us. If you have any questions, please call your sponsoring congregation or the Vail Religious Foundation office. The fee for the chapel allows for a one (1) hour rehearsal the day prior to your wedding and the designated buyout timeslot for the wedding ceremony which includes two outdoor, creekside terraces for pictures before and after the wedding, the inside and outside of the property and newly designed Bridal Suite for hair/makeup during your timeslot, and the Creekside Fellowship Room with Sliding Glass Doors to the outside Wiegers Terrace.
